Target dummy dps is misleading, and the numbers will be different spec-by-spec because some specs are reliant on execute phases and things like that which the dummies don't simulate.

Your best bet is to hop into lfr and see what kind of damage you can do on an actual boss mob. I'd expect 35-40k from a pvp geared sin rogue. You'll see people with lower ilevel do way more damage if they have pve set bonuses and trinkets.
 
Arms is still really good but you have to cheese out all of the executes that you can. When you're just sitting there dpsing a boss it's depressing, but when an add pops up and you get a couple sweeping strikes executes on it at the end you shoot up in damage.

It's funny because when there are two arms wars in the same raid, they sort of screw each other out of damage by killing adds too quickly between 20% and 0, so they both get half as many executes off.

Mythics drop 685 gear baseline, but can warforge roll all the way upto 725 (735 valor upgraded), which makes some mythic dungeon loot better than anything that drops in heroic HFC.

A better way to analyze a spec's performance would be to use Warcraft Logs, but even then it's not perfect. People tend to gravitate towards specs and talents that are decided as the best, even if the difference isn't that significant, and that plays into how specs rank.

https://www.warcraftlogs.com/statistics/8

Difficulty, time range, percentile, and the like can be customized to get what you are looking for, and you can always look at individual logs as well.
